The Repsol Honda Team brilliantly disputed the 12th appointment of the MotoGP season, which took place today at the Misano Adriatico circuit. Dani Pedrosa and Andrea Dovizioso honored the name of the Team they represent by grasping respectively a well deserved first position and a solid fourth place.
Courtesy of one of his demon starts and furthered by the pole position, Daniel Pedrosa was the protagonist of the San Marino GP and the author of a perfect performance. Pedrosa lead the race during all the 26 laps, pulling away from Lorenzo at the third lap and opening a clear 1.5s gap over the rival. The fourth victory of the year was useful to Dani to strengthen his second position in the Championship, as he is keeping it thanks to the 208 points.
“No words can describe this victory” stated Dani “I was happy I won but as I heard about Shoya it felt like nothing to me. Things like that are terrible and should never happen. I still can’t believe it. Anyway, my weekend was good and today we conquered the victory. Now I want to keep my feet on the ground and think about next challenge”.
Andrea Dovizioso did his best to recover after starting from the eight position of the grid. The Italian had no doubt about the fact he wanted to finish his home GP with a good placement and he made it. As the red lights blinked off, Dovi immediately moved to the fifth position, he attacked Casey Stoner at the 12th lap and prevailed on him conquering the fourth spot. Thanks to the solid position, Dovizioso is still in third in the point standings.
“My thoughts are with Shoya, I’m so sorry for his family” said Andrea “two bad accidents in two races are terrible and they make us remember how dangerous our job is. Concerning to the race we did the maximum. Today the pace was better than yesterday’s one and I was able to improve a lot till finishing in fourth. We’ll start from here for next race ”.
Whilst the first and the second podium spots went to two Spaniards, Pedrosa and Lorenzo, after they both rode a solitary race; the third spot was contended between Valentino Rossi and Casey Stoner, but at the end it went to the Italian home rider.
Unfortunately the Gran Premio Aperol di San Marino e della Riviera di Rimini was featured by a lot of astonishment and a lot of sadness due to the unexpected loss of the Moto2 rider Shoya Tomizawa, victim of a bad accident. All the MotoGP riders and workers will not forget the young rider.
The Top Class will be back on track on September 19th for the A-Style Grand Prix of Aragon.

Moto2
After starting from pole position, in front of Scott Redding, Julian Simon and Jules Cluzel, Toni Elias ruled the tragic Moto2 challenge, which bitterly registered a very tough accident after which Shoya Tomizawa passed away. At the end of the 26 laps, the race of the intermediate category saw Elias winning the San Marino GP, whilst the second and third positions went to Julian Simon and Thomas Luthi. Courtesy of today’s victory Elias extended his advantage in the standings, as he has an 83-point gap now, whilst Simon moved up to the second spot. Luthi is third.
125cc
Marc Marquez grasped his sixth victory of the 2010 season after starting from the second position of the grid, behind Bradley Smith and followed by Nico Terol and Pol Espargaro. The rider of the Red Bull Ajo Motorsport Team was also able to strengthen his leadership in the Championship and extended to nine points the advantage over Terol. The podium of the Gran Premio Aperol di San Marino e della Riviera di Rimini was also conquered by Terol as well, second classified after a tough start, and by Efren Vazquez.
